Shenoy Nursing Home has been a landmark since 1963 as Secunderabad’s first Private Healthcare institution. Founded in 1963 by the Late Dr. B. Laxman Shenoy and his wife Dr. Vidya Devi Shenoy, it has become an icon of Medical excellence, recording close to 52,000 births. Interestingly, at Shenoy, more than a thousand twins have been delivered; perhaps one of the reasons for which Secunderabad can be called the ‘twin city’! Shenoy Hospitals has renowned doctors and advanced facilities and almost covers all Medical disciplines. It has dedicated departments for Obstetrics and Gynecology, one of its key strengths, including Fertility (Male & Female), Pediatrics, and Neonatology. Add to that: ENT, Orthopedics, Physiotherapy, Urology, Pulmonology, Gastroenterology, General Surgery, Cardiology and Anesthesiology. Plus, Shenoy Hospitals has departments for Dentistry & Orthodontics, Dermatology, Endocrinology, Plastic, Aesthetic & Reconstructive Surgery, Andrology. The hospital also has a dedicated Dietician and Psychologist.

A 15,000 square-feet, three-story building, Shenoy Hospitals has 50 patient beds and 2 birthing suites – all state-of-the-art rooms. There is also a separate, two-story building for Outpatient care. The hospital has an NICU and SICU, a Modular OT, and an Emergency Care Unit (with ambulance service). The other facilities include an Ultrasound Scanning department, X-Ray room, a Pathology Laboratory, a Pharmacy, and a canteen. It also has valet parking. Dr. Vidya Devi Shenoy, who started Shenoy Nursing Home in 1963, says:

“I am very happy to be present for the re-opening of Shenoy Hospitals on 5th Oct, 2017. I had a great vision that after me, it should be taken over by a proper person and I am happy that my daughter Dr. Mamata Deenadayal and Dr. Deenadayal are opening the hospital. My plan in 1963, was to have a multi-speciality hospital but due to my health issues, I had to turn Shenoy Nursing Home into a single speciality birthing place. Now it is back as a multi-speciality hospital for Family healthcare and I am glad that my family will be maintaining it, and is now going to be called ‘Shenoy Hospitals’. They have done an excellent job with using all the latest medical equipment and technology which can increase efficiency and most importantly help patients better. I am sure they will do a great job handling it and I wish them all the very best.”
